Staggering

Charity Bryson

twenty years buried behind this shield
of waxing and waning fat cells
protecting the heart of my sexuality
as lovers penetrated then abandoned my world

once, vindicated in my wrath
by men who would consume me
then acceding to the asylum of obesity

now crippling pain demands
that obesity relinquish its hold on me

vulnerability:
I stand on a precipice
staggering
between
armor
and
perilous love
